2016-17 Panini Threads NBA hobby boxes & cases
Threads is a simple formula but it’s a comfortable one with two hits per box — one autograph and one memorabilia card — and a feel that’s more deluxe than, say, NBA Hoops but still with some of the basics that give it a good collectable feel. (Check out this past break.) You can land ink from the likes of Kobe Bryant and Carmelo Anthony here along with ink from the rookies, too. The memorabilia cards can include Hall of Famers, too, like that past break does, helping offer some extra scope for a price that’s now pretty low. It’s worth a rip for sure and it leads off this round of picks from this collector.

This wax box may offer easiest way to pull a Bryce Harper autograph

Bryce-Harper-2009-USABryce Harper is the reigning National League MVP and easily one of the first names mentioned when someones asks “Who’s the best player in the game today?”

Collectors who have been around have known his name for several years now — he made his cardboard debut way back in the 2008-09 USA Baseball boxed set as a member of the 16U National Team — but the high demand for his autographs arguably hasn’t waned since his dramatic entry into the national consciousness on the cover of Sports Illustrated as a 16-year-old.

He’s signed plenty of autographs, but there’s still plenty of demand. Check eBay or COMC and you’ll see the lowest asking prices for his ink pushing or topping the $200 mark and that puts him out of reach for a lot of collectors.
